Adapting PR strategies crucial for business growth

"Strategies Adaptation"

Online businesses have seen increased complexity and challenges regarding their communication over the past decade. Chief Communication Officers (CCOs) are facing the pressure of managing the company’s reputation and investor relations, which calls for an evolution in traditional PR approaches.

The digital world has added an extra layer of complexity with its various communication channels. Amid these complexities, CCOs are to remain undeterred in ensuring seamless flow of information. Cultural sensitivities due to the global reach of businesses serve as a further dimension to this issue.

Consequently, adapting PR approaches has become non-negotiable for businesses aiming at survival and success. An alignment of communication strategies with business goals has become vital for efficiency.

Investors, a crucial segment of stakeholders, base their decisions on solid, quantifiable data rather than mere promises. This disposition necessitates that businesses consistently keep their communication profitable and engaging with investors.

It’s necessary to adjust conventional PR strategies to meet investors’ fundamental expectations. They desire concrete outcomes, verified data, and realistic company projections. Therefore, an effective communication strategy should balance enthusiasm with a realistic approach based on the company’s financial and operational realities.

Investors greatly value consistent achievement of measurable and achievable targets. They appreciate transparent communication and see it as an essential aspect of successful venture.

Optimizing PR approaches for business resilience

Showing resilience in the face of challenges yield positive impressions in investors, influencing their investment decisions.

Companies need to know that investors are not very receptive to PR gimmicks. They prefer companies that openly address their challenges. Accountability during difficult times can earn respect from the investors, distinguishing a company from its competitors. Such companies exhibit a high level of integrity that fosters trust and encourages investment.

Though PR practitioners might find complexity appealing, investors view it as potential risk. They prefer straightforward, accurate, and concise explanations. The focus should be on delivering accurate information and addressing potential ambiguities to manage or mitigate any conceivable risk.

Success seldom invites criticism, but it often breeds higher expectations for future performances. Companies should view their successes as launching pads for greater achievements and not become negligent of future goals.

A company’s value ultimately revolves around tangible figures for investors, but the way the company narrates its story significantly impacts its perception and valuation. Therefore, the power of compelling narration can’t be underestimated in effective company communication and long-term growth. Mastering corporate communication across all levels is pivotal in fostering a valuable and enduring business.
